What Is an Extortion Defense Lawyer and How Do They Help?
Extortion, described under California Penal Code Section 518, occurs when someone threatening another person to gain money, property, or an official act. The offense is a felony and can lead to two to four years in state prison, along with fines, restitution, and a lasting copyright. An extortion defense lawyer is focused on challenge the prosecution's evidence and safeguard your constitutional rights throughout all steps of the legal process.
In practical terms, the process of an extortion defense lawyer begins with a thorough review of how the charge arose. This involves analyzing text messages, emails, voicemails, financial records, and third-party accounts. The attorney then locates weaknesses in the prosecution's narrative — such as insufficient evidence of force — and builds a defense plan around those gaps.

Can extortion charges be dropped before trial?Yes — extortion charges are dismissed before trial with greater frequency than many people think. Well-executed pretrial motions attacking procedural violations, combined with a strong showing of insufficient intent, can lead a judge or prosecutor to drop or modify the case. Will I need to testify during proceedings in my own extortion case?Appearing as a witness is completely your decision — you cannot be forced to testify against yourself under the Fifth Amendment. Your extortion defense lawyer will counsel you on if taking the stand strengthens or weakens your defense based on the record presented at trial. This decision is always made jointly between you and your attorney.
What are typical defenses used in extortion cases?Common and effective extortion defenses involve no credible threat, mistaken identity, and the lawful right to demand payment of a legitimate debt.
